“Former Hollyoaks Actor’s Grandmother Ruth Ellis Pardoned Posthumously”

Published on

Former Hollyoaks actor Stephen Beard received news of his grandmother Ruth Ellis being posthumously pardoned, the last woman executed in Britain, while having dinner with friends. The 38-year-old father of four expressed the emotional moment as the culmination of a long campaign for justice.

Stephen described the moment as amazing, lifting his eyes to the sky in remembrance of Ruth and his mother. The family had carried the burden for a long time, but now they could finally lay it down. Ruth’s death had a profound impact across generations, but the idea of “bad blood” stemming from the past events was now resolved.

The posthumous conditional pardon for Ruth, who fatally shot her abusive lover David Blakely in 1955, was granted by King Charles and announced by Deputy Prime Minister David Lammy in Parliament. The death penalty was replaced with a life imprisonment sentence, acknowledging that modern defenses like loss of control or diminished responsibility could have been considered in her case.

Ruth, a Welsh-born nightclub hostess, was hanged at 28 after being convicted of Blakely’s murder. Her family had long argued for her pardon, citing her victimization by emotional and physical abuse at the hands of Blakely.

Stephen, who works internationally in data centers and resides in Dubai, always believed Ruth’s trial was flawed, lacking critical evidence of her abuse and mental state. The case not only captured public attention but also cast a shadow over Ruth’s family through the years.

The repercussions of Ruth’s tragedy extended through the generations, with her former husband and son both dying by suicide. Her adopted daughter, Georgina, faced alcohol abuse and succumbed to cancer at 50. Stephen shared the weight of his grandmother’s crime and the injustice she suffered but found closure in Ruth’s pardon, completing what his mother had started.

He expressed pride in his mother’s determination to seek Ruth’s pardon, highlighting the importance of rewriting history to right past wrongs. Reflecting on Ruth’s final moments, where she displayed bravery, inspired Stephen despite the lingering impact on the family.

As Ruth’s grandson, Stephen acknowledged the complexity of his family history but credited her resilience for instilling fearlessness in him. He planned to honor her memory by displaying her picture at home, emphasizing her identity beyond the notorious label of a cold-blooded killer.
